Output 31490be57c92ad5ea816a9e2c19a2d159db9867c7e82bb5d1604eb0cd91b31df:7

value
155494941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32e0817681d4c490c8b414471e5233071ab560de OP_EQUAL
address
MCYAxxBXZwouBrUHhtLf84hJx9xpYVyEVu
transaction
31490be57c92ad5ea816a9e2c19a2d159db9867c7e82bb5d1604eb0cd91b31df
spent
true